Description
In order to support the responsible adoption of AI by councils, the LGA wishes to work with a supplier to develop a toolkit to support councils to evaluate new and existing AI focused initiatives.
The toolkit will provide practical, versatile, clear, and concise support to council officers, enabling them to confidently design and conduct evaluations of AI solutions.
It should be developed in collaboration with local government digital officers, AI practitioners, and senior leaders, ensuring it reflects the realities of the sector.
This should reflect existing procurement and assurance processes and existing AI evaluation guidance from central government, but should be responsive to local government contexts.
The toolkit must be grounded in the local government context and informed by the lived experiences of AI adoption at the local level. It should focus on the specific challenges that councils face in evaluating AI, rather than drawing too narrowly on insights from the general evaluation literature.
